Our post will explore the various ways sunrooms add real value to your home and why you should consider installing one. What Is The ROI For A Sunroom? Not all sunrooms are built exactly the same. The exact ROI of a sunroom really comes down to your space’s details, such as: Location The quality of construction Size and style Home integration The type of sunroom (three-season vs four-season) Local real estate demand and trends According to Angi, most homeowners can expect to see a return on investment (ROI) of at least 49% on their sunroom.
